Fine-Tuning Product Regimens for Warmer Days


One of the most effective means to refresh a skincare protocol is by reconsidering the products your clients utilize daily. As temperature levels climb, hefty occlusive products might no more serve them well. Consider recommending lighter hydration and changing from abundant creams to gel-based or water-based alternatives.


Cleansing is an additional vital location where refined changes can make a considerable difference. In the spring, the skin may generate even more oil and sweat, particularly with boosted activity and time outdoors. Suggest stabilizing cleansers that sustain the skin obstacle while completely removing impurities. Urge customers to prevent severe stripping items, which can activate more oil manufacturing and level of sensitivity.


Naturally, SPF is non-negotiable year-round, but springtime is an excellent time to increase down on sun defense. With longer daytime hours and more time invested outside, a broad-spectrum SPF ought to be part of every early morning routine. Deal clients alternatives that feel light-weight and breathable to support day-to-day wear.

Addressing Seasonal Skin Stressors Head-On


Spring isn't just sunlight and roses. It additionally brings seasonal allergic reactions, raised plant pollen, and a greater likelihood of irritation or flare-ups. As a proactive skincare professional, expect these issues and build preventative measures right into your customer procedures.


Search for signs of animated skin, such as inflammation, dryness, or itching, specifically in customers susceptible to seasonal allergic reactions. Concentrate on soothing ingredients and obstacle support. Recommend way of living modifications, such as cleaning the face after being outdoors, to minimize allergen direct exposure.


Hydration stays essential, also as humidity surges. However hydration does not have to suggest heavy. Urge using hydrating mists, lotions with hyaluronic acid, and light-weight lotions that soak up rapidly while maintaining the skin plump.
